Output 41c15416c1483447659b08674a398bcd7bce481122486c5e1cde92395927e1c2:9

value
23071739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2970fe337f2c755d9a360605fd47d5a524288745 OP_EQUAL
address
MBgHJBfRrdi3KFrXCGPM6p7t22WXKYNQ3V
transaction
41c15416c1483447659b08674a398bcd7bce481122486c5e1cde92395927e1c2
spent
true